基于Flask和TensorFlow的中文语音识别系统源码与部署

版权申诉
0 下载量 108 浏览量 更新于2024-10-31 收藏 5.98MB ZIP 举报
资源摘要信息:"Python优秀项目 基于Flask+TensorFlow实现的深度学习的中文语音识别系统源码+数据集+部署文档+数据资料" 一、项目概述: 本项目是基于Python语言,结合Flask框架和TensorFlow深度学习框架实现的中文语音识别系统。通过这个系统,用户能够将中文语音转化为文本信息。系统采用了深度学习技术,通过训练神经网络模型来提高识别的准确度。项目中包含了完整的源码、所需的数据集、部署文档以及相关数据资料,便于使用者快速上手,并在自定义数据上进行应用和开发。 二、技术栈: 1. Python:作为项目开发的主要语言,Python以其简洁和强大的库支持著称,在数据科学、机器学习领域拥有广泛的使用。 2. Flask:一个轻量级的Web应用框架,用于构建后端服务,提供API接口,使得项目能够接收语音输入,并返回识别后的文本。 3. TensorFlow:由Google开发的开源机器学习库,用于设计、训练和部署深度学习模型,是本项目深度学习功能实现的核心。 4. 其他技术:本项目可能还会涉及到语音处理、数据预处理、模型调优等技术,这些技术是完成语音识别任务所必不可少的。 三、项目内容: 1. 源码:项目的核心代码,包括数据处理、模型训练和后端服务的实现。 2. 数据集:用于训练和测试的中文语音数据集,可能包含了各种场景下的语音数据。 3. 部署文档:详细说明了如何在服务器或本地环境中部署该项目,包括环境搭建、库安装、服务启动等步骤。 4. 数据资料:可能包含一些背景资料、参考资料、实验结果等,帮助理解项目细节和优化点。 四、部署和运行: 1. 环境要求:项目要求Python版本为3.7或更高,需要确保IDE环境(例如IntelliJ IDEA)已配置好Python环境。 2. 运行步骤: - 步骤一:使用IDE(推荐IDEA)打开项目文件夹。 - 步骤二:根据部署文档或程序运行提示,安装所有必需的Python库。 - 步骤三:点击IDE中的运行按钮,启动Flask服务,等待服务完全启动。 3. 如果在运行过程中遇到任何问题,可以根据错误提示进行调试修改,如果无法解决,可以私信博主寻求帮助。 五、项目支持服务: 项目提供定制服务,如果用户有特定需求,如其他Python项目辅导、程序定制开发或科研合作等,可以与博主联系,提供: 1. Python或人工智能项目辅导:帮助学习者理解项目细节、提高技术水平。 2. Python或人工智能程序定制:根据用户需求定制开发Python程序。 3. Python科研合作:在科研项目上提供合作,共同进行研究和开发。 六、相关技术标签: Flask和Python是项目的两个主要技术标签。Flask作为后端框架,负责提供服务和接口;Python作为编程语言,负责编写程序逻辑和算法。 七、文件压缩包内容: 1. python系统部署文档.md:详细描述了如何部署基于Python的系统。 2. Flask系统部署文档.md:具体指导如何使用Flask框架来部署一个完整的后端服务。 3. ***.zip:压缩文件,可能包含了项目源码、数据集和部署文档。 4. ASRT_SpeechRecognition-master:源码仓库目录,可能是项目的主要代码库。 通过对以上内容的详细解读,可以看出该项目是一个功能完备的中文语音识别系统,不仅提供了可以直接运行的源码,还提供了完整的部署文档和数据集,非常适合对深度学习、语音识别感兴趣的开发者和科研人员进行学习和使用。